At Liberty Health, we understand the unique needs of our patients and families facing terminal illness. That is why we provide our hospice patients with state-of-the-art care and pain management services, delivered by our specially trained staff with emphasis on strength, dignity and compassion.


Job Summary:

  • Apply a working knowledge of nursing theories and concepts to provide high-quality patient care.
  • Responsible for care and documentation of care, which meets reimbursement guidelines and ensures compliance with regulatory requirements.
  • Coordinate physical care of the patient with family, patient, physician and Hospice team to ensure seamless care delivery.
  • Communicate effectively with patients/families at all levels, including verbal and written communication.
  • Communicate with all agency personnel, including Clinical Manager, Administrator, Operations Support Technician, and other disciplines on the care team.
  • Attend and participate in Interdisciplinary Team (IDT) meetings and quality review as scheduled by the agency to ensure quality care delivery.

Job Requirements:

  • Current RN licensure in state of practice, successful completion of a nursing education from an approved school of nursing with two years of clinical nursing experience and at least one year of hospice nursing experience preferred.
  • Frequent contact with the Clinical Manager, Administrator, Operations Support Technician, and other agency personnel.
  • Frequent contact with other disciplines on the care team as well as customers and vendors from other agencies.
  • Maintain a working knowledge of the principles and practice of nursing according to nursing practice act, agencies policies and procedures, and reimbursement guidelines.
  • Ability to communicate effectively, both orally and in writing, and use a computer with a working knowledge of a variety of computer applications.
  • Constantly able to use high-level problemsolving, critical thinking, and reasoning skills for use in patient care planning and problem resolution.
  • Must be able to be cheerful and represent a positive, professional first impression at all times.
  • Available to travel as needed across the Hospice coverage area.
